Job Summary

Soledad High School NJROTC is seeking a highly motivated retired Navy, Marine, or Coast Guard Enlisted (E7 – E9) to fill an immediate opening as one of the Naval Science Instructors (NSI). Duties include classroom instruction of Navy-developed curriculum as well as program administrative functions. Involvement in after-school and weekend unit activities is also required. This position offers a 12-month contract at Navy Minimum Instructor Pay (MIP) on a traditional school schedule. NJROTC certification is required, and if hired, the candidate must be willing to obtain the required ROTC credential.
